What counts as a plumbing emergency

Not every drip is an emergency, and we won't pretend otherwise to charge an emergency rate. In Brighton & Hove we class it as urgent when water is escaping faster than you can contain it, when a leak is near electrics or coming through a light fitting, when the whole property has lost its water supply, or when your only toilet is out of action. Anything safely isolated can wait for a standard slot at a standard price.

Should I turn my water off before you arrive?

If water is escaping, yes — isolate the main stopcock, usually under the kitchen sink or where the supply enters the property. If you can't find or turn it, say so on the call and we'll talk you through the options, including the outside stop valve.

Can you fix a burst pipe permanently on the first visit?

Usually. Engineers carry common pipe sizes, fittings and isolation valves. Where a specific part is needed — for example a cylinder component — the leak is made safe on the first visit and the repair completed as soon as the part is in hand.
